Traditional men’s toilet feeds have long been criticized for their lack of hygiene and privacy. However, modern solutions are leveraging technology to revolutionize this scenario. Touchless fixtures, including faucets, soap dispensers, and hand dryers, minimize the spread of germs and enhance sanitary conditions. Smart toilets that feature self-cleaning technologies, bidet functions, and automatic flush systems not only elevate the user experience but also contribute to environmental conservation by reducing water usage.

Another significant breakthrough in this field is the development of antimicrobial coatings. These coatings are applied to surfaces like door handles, stall locks, and toilet seats to inhibit the growth of bacteria, viruses, and fungi. This innovation is a game-changer for public restrooms, especially in high-traffic areas, ensuring a cleaner and safer environment.

Efficiency and Environmental Considerations

The conventional men’s toilet feed system often falls short in efficiency and environmental friendliness. However, the advent of waterless urinals and dual-flush toilets presents a formidable response to these challenges. Waterless urinals, utilizing non-water-based systems, drastically reduce water wastage, leading to significant environmental and economic benefits. Dual-flush toilets offer the option to choose the volume of water per flush, empowering users to contribute to water conservation efforts. These advancements are not only better for the planet but also reduce operational costs for facilities.

Eco-friendly materials are now increasingly used in the construction of restroom facilities. Recycled plastics, bio-composites, and sustainably sourced wood products are making their way into everything from toilet partitions to countertops. Such materials not only reduce the environmental footprint but also offer durability and resistance against vandalism.

Privacy and Comfort: Priority in Design

Advancements in toilet design also emphasize user privacy and comfort, addressing a significant drawback of traditional men’s toilets. Modern restroom layouts are seeing the introduction of full-height, floor-to-ceiling stall partitions and doors. These designs greatly enhance privacy, providing a more comfortable and secure space for individuals.

Lighting and ventilation have also received attention in the design of contemporary men’s restrooms. Optimized natural lighting and efficient ventilation systems not only improve the aesthetics but also play a crucial role in maintaining air quality and reducing the proliferation of odors.
